Abstract(in English) | To mitigate digital divide within the super smart society, we have been studying an autonomous in-formation delivery service, called Tales of Familiar (ToF). ToF retrieves information from various data sources including direct messages, Web resources, and ubiquitous sensors. Then, it picks up relevant information based on preference of every user. Finally, a familiar deployed in the physical environment tells the information as tales to the user. In this paper, to see the practical feasibility of ToF, we implement a prototype of ToF, and conduct preliminary experiments in a real environment. To address problems found in the experiment, we also propose a method that excludes similar tales, and improve the scoring method so as to better reflect user’s interests. |
